An Ontario alcohol retailer is recalling free tumblers (handleless glasses) with neutral beverages as part of a promotion. The product is being recalled due to safety concerns.
Nütrl Canada said the manufacturer notified them of the voluntary recall. These were given away as free gifts in April and May at LCBO stores. Tumblers can emit toxic substances when filled with liquid due to manufacturing errors.
The tumbler was given as a gift with the purchase of Nütrl Vodka Soda products. A Nütrl representative said they are working with Health Canada to bring the matter to the attention of consumers.
People who have taken Tumbaler are advised to stop using it immediately and call 1-866-846-1778 for more information.
